Biography

Per-Åke Nygren is a Professor at the Royal Institute of Technology (KTH) in the School of Biotechnology. He serves as the Head of the Division of Protein Technology and leads the Affinity Protein Engineering group. His research interests focus on affinity protein biotechnology, particularly in aspects of affinity chromatography, diagnostics, and serum half-life extension for biologicals and biotherapy. He has an extensive track record in working with natural and engineered forms of bacterial serum protein binding proteins, particularly immunoglobulin binding regions. Since the mid-1990s, he has pioneered the concept of affibody binding proteins by employing combinatorial protein engineering and protein library technology to develop novel non-immunoglobulin binding proteins. His work continues to involve applications of engineered variants developed for use in protein microarrays, diagnostic assays, and cancer diagnostics. Additionally, he focuses on refining protein library selection systems including phage display and ribosome display.
